If a qualified appraisal was not done, you can always refer to tax records from that year to get a general idea of the land's value. However, the safest way to obtain a valuation on this land as of 20 years ago is to get a retroactive appraisal. This is especially important if the value of the land was/is significant. Real estate professionals in your area may be able to recommend an appraiser who specializes in retroactive appraisals.
